Playwright Ensler Returns with 'Good Body'

»
from Morning Edition, Monday , November 15, 2004
Playwright Eve Ensler became an international phenomenon with her one-woman show, The Vagina Monologues. Now she's back with a new play about the rest of the female anatomy. It's called The Good Body, and it follows Ensler's own attempts to make peace with her aging figure.
